Meet Jakeena Geobani of Keena Konnects – Where Life Meets Purpose

Today we’d like to introduce you to Jakeena Geobani.

Hi Jakeena, we’d love for you to start by introducing yourself.
I am a Certified Life Coach, Facilitator, Motivational Empowerment Speaker, and Founder and CEO of Keena Konnects LLC! My passion is providing a listening ear and liberating advice to those in need of clarity and guidance.

This passion started as a child, I have always wanted to help those that didn’t have a strong support system readily available. I grew up feeling lost and uncertain of my worth and there were not many people around that I could trust to share how I was feeling. This led to some bad decisions and my life got off track, it took years to course correct but I made it. Having this experience led me to open up Keena Konnects because I never want anyone to be in a space where they feel that no one cares or that their voice doesn’t matter.

I have been a coach to many people over the course of my 18 years working in corporate America. Last year with the support and encouragement of my wife I decided to open Keena Konnects, Where Life Meets Purpose. Having my own business fills my life with purpose. When I see my clients achieve their goals, overcome self-limiting mindsets, and feel empowered, it brings me sincere joy! Keena Konnects is about helping people in society have a safe space to be exactly who they are meant to be, a place where all are welcome to reconnect with their true selves uncover talents, and live a life of purpose.

We all face challenges, but looking back would you describe it as a relatively smooth road?
This road has not been smooth at all. Deciding to launch a business during a pandemic while working full-time and having a baby was a struggle. Many people said, “stick with your day job”, I was questioned about why I wanted to be a Life Coach and that my 9-5 should be good enough. I need to leave a legacy for my children. I want my great-great-grandchildren to know my name and the sacrifices I made to ensure they can live a life filled with meaning and joy.

I want everyone to know that if you have a dream it can be achieved with the right support and guidance. There were times in my past when I didn’t want to live anymore, I felt hopeless and that my dreams would not manifest. Now I see life totally differently and I will help others see things differently too. Partnership, accountability, trust, and support are some of the things I provide to my clients.

Thanks for sharing that. So, maybe next you can tell us a bit more about your business?
Keena Konnects offers individual and group coaching. I am an author of a positive self-talk book and journal. I plan monthly events under my brand to bring individuals together (yoga in the park, sharing circles, and paint and shares). I specialize in mindset shifts to have a new paradigm on life and personal capabilities. My focus is to uncover the self-limiting beliefs that cause people to not reach their goals.

I want people to know that I am trustworthy, sincere, and their biggest cheerleader. I want to empower people to feel they matter and are worthy of greatness. I listen without judgment and we create a realistic plan of action to live a life of purpose. I am proud of my brand because I get to use my given talents to connect with people effortlessly. I create a safe space of hope and liberation to take on life’s challenges and still be successful.
